Determine the direction of the force that will act on the charge in each of the following situations. A positive charge moving to the right in a magnetic field that points out of the screen. A positive charge moving to the right in an electric field that points out of the screen. A negative charge moving out of the screen in a magnetic field that points into the screen.

a) the force goes down, b) The electric force is out of the screen

c) the force is zero

Explanation:

To determine the direction of a magnetic force we use the right hand rule. For a positive charge, the thumb is in the direction of speed, the fingers extended in the direction of the magnetic field, and the palm points in the direction of force. Let's apply this to our case

a) thumb   to the right

 Fingers spread out

And the force goes down

b) the electric force in the direction of the electric field if the charge is positive

 Positive charge

Electric field out of the screen

The electric force is out of the screen

c) charge moving out screen

   Magnetic field entered on the screen

Since they are parallel, therefore the force is zero
